Чтобы установить непрозрачность курсора с помощью CSS, вы можете использовать следующие методы:
-
Цвет RGBA. Непрозрачность курсора можно изменить, задав для цвета курсора значение RGBA. Альфа-канал (последнее значение) управляет непрозрачностью. Например:
cursor: url('cursor.png'), rgba(0, 0, 0, 0.5);В этом примере файл курсора.png представляет собой пользовательское изображение курсора, а цвет курсора установлен на черный с непрозрачностью 0,5.
-
Пользовательское изображение курсора. Вы можете создать собственное изображение курсора с желаемой непрозрачностью, используя инструмент редактирования изображений, например Photoshop или GIMP. Сохраните изображение в формате, поддерживающем прозрачность, например PNG. Затем используйте следующий код CSS:
cursor: url('cursor.png'), auto;Замените «cursor.png» на путь к вашему собственному изображению курсора.
-
Переходы CSS. Если вы хотите анимировать изменение непрозрачности курсора, вы можете использовать переходы CSS вместе со свойством непрозрачности. Вот пример:
cursor: url('cursor.png'), auto; transition: opacity 0.5s ease-in-out; opacity: 0.5;В этом примере для изображения курсора установлено значение «cursor.png», а непрозрачность изначально установлена на 0,5. При наведении курсора на элемент непрозрачность плавно меняется в течение 0,5 секунды.